Family of slain Durban man puts up reward for information
Updated | By Lauren Beukes
The family of a Durban man who was murdered along with his girlfriend - is offering a R20,000 reward for information that could lead to the arrest of the assailants.
Bradley Hiralal from Phoenix- and his girlfriend Bilquees Hussain from Newlands West were shot in a drive-by shooting in Umhlanga in late last month.

Hussain died at the scene - while Hiralal died on the way to hospital.
Police haven't yet arrested anyone.

Hiralal's brother - Denver is pleading with those who have any information to come forward. "I miss everything about him. It's devastating, we did not get a chance to say goodbye."
He adds, " The whole family is shattered, it's so hard to deal with and even harder because his murderer is on the run and there's someone whose harbouring him."
